Beyond Bioextraction: The Role of Oyster-Mediated Denitrification in Nutrient Management
Abstract
Recently, interest has grown in using oyster-mediated denitrification resulting from aquaculture and restoration as mechanisms for reactive nitrogen (N) removal.
